We moved my wife in October, and it has been a very positive experience. Arden Courts has excellent personnel and a good facility. They have live music every day. They have excellent programing for amusement and learning. She has been treated excellently. They have a staff psychiatrist available who also has a specialty in neurology. They have internal medicine people, registered nurses, and plenty of aides. I think it is probably the best one we have seen. The facility has four wings, and each wing has its own TV room and places to eat. My wife enjoys the food.

Arden Court in San Antonio is a very nice place. They are very caring. This one has a beautiful walkway path. The rooms are single rooms with a closet, a bed, a private bath, dressers, and have a garden view. They have music, exercise programs, physical activities, and games. My father enjoys the food. They have four different small dining rooms, so it is more intimate, like a family style, with the kitchens attached to the dining room. They are clean and well lit. The meals seem to be enjoyed by the residents. The chairs are comfortable, and the tables are nice. We like the setup, and we like the caring attitude from the staff. I like how all the doctors come in to the facility.

I cannot say enough good things about Arden Courts in San Antonio. My mother is happy and well-adjusted. The staff is terrific. The layout gives a great deal of freedom of movement for the residents, and this is especially important for my mother who hates to feel locked in. There is a neuro-psychiatrist available who has been invaluable in getting my mother stabilized. Before Arden Courts, she was psychotic and out of control at another memory care center. Now she is happy and well adjusted. Part of it was finding the right medication, but a lot of it has to do without the awesome facility and very caring and knowledgeable staff. This facility usually has a waiting list, so it is a good idea to plan ahead if you would like to place your loved one here.

Arden Courts has an enclosed area where residents can go outside. They have four different areas, what they call houses, and each house have their own little porch inside. They have certain staff for each area so that the patients can get oriented. There was also a very nice courtyard. The staff was very nice and very dedicated people. Some of them have worked there for numbers of years. I was told they've grown to love the people and they feel like they can reach out and touch the people in a way to help them through their rehabilitation.

Memory Care

Memory Care is specifically designed to meet the needs of those with Alzheimer's or other forms of dementia. Specially trained staff members assist with activities of daily living (such as bathing and dressing) and provide therapies to slow further loss of cognitive abilities.
